TN/AL Joint Meet Poll

Here is the post Alabama Frog made in the Joint meet thread.

My 2005 Trailer Life campground directory has no listings for Fayetteville, kinda surprising since it’s a decent sized city.
The Fayetteville fair is a great idea but it shore is a hard place to find accommodations around.

According to google maps;

Tennessee Valley RV Park is at exit 14 ¼ mile east of I-65 and 18 miles (22min) from Fayetteville (looks small but shady from satellite photos)

Tims Ford campground is in the state park and 28 miles (56min) from Fayetteville (looks real interesting from satellite photos and has the State Park thing going for it)


Lynchburg campground is 15 miles (27 min) from Fayetteville (and looks boring from the satellite photos but has the Jack Daniels distillery very close by)

Texas T campground is also close to I-65 at exit 27 and is 32 miles (37min) from Fayetteville (also looks boring from the satellite photos).

Monte Sano in Huntsville is 35 miles (56min)

The Space and Rocket center Campground is on I-565 in Huntsville and is 33 miles (49min) It’s a pretty nice place and easy to get in and out to the interstate with a nice Marriott hotel next door and is walking distance to the space and rocket center but is kinda far South for the TN folks and nearly and hour away from Fayetteville

I don’t know, what do yall think?
We need camping and hotel and preferably close together and stuff for the wives and kids to do besides talking about trucks.
I’m game for whatever yall want, I just would like to meet everyone and look at each others trucks. __________________
